What are Active Ingredients of this product?
- DIMETHICONE .28 g/g - a linear silicone; an ingredient of SIMETHICONE; lotion of dimeticone in a volatile silicone base has been used to treat LICE
- WHITE PETROLATUM .48 g/g - A colloidal system of semisolid hydrocarbons obtained from PETROLEUM. It is used as an ointment base, topical protectant, and lubricant.
